This one might be expensive. It could be a number of things. Is your mineral oil res. full? If so it could be either the power steering pump *it controls the flow of your mineral oil giving it partial pressure* or your nitrogen ball could need replacing.

1998 jaguar xk8 convertible stopped working?

If your 1998 Jaguar XK8 convertible has stopped working, it could be due to several issues such as a dead battery, faulty alternator, or electrical problems. Check the battery connections and ensure the battery is charged. If the electrical system seems fine, consider inspecting the fuses, starter motor, or fuel system for potential failures. Consulting a professional mechanic with experience in Jaguars may be necessary for a thorough diagnosis.

How can you erase CATS system fault warning in a 2001 Jaguar s type 4 0 when suspension is ok?

To erase the CATS (Computer Active Technology Suspension) system fault warning in a 2001 Jaguar S-Type 4.0, you can try disconnecting the car's battery for about 15-20 minutes, which may reset the system. If the warning persists, using an OBD-II scanner to clear the fault codes can also help. Additionally, ensure there are no underlying issues with the suspension system, as the warning may reappear if faults are detected. If problems continue, consulting a professional mechanic or Jaguar specialist is advisable.
